Job Summary
Under direct supervision, the full-time California Licensed Outpatient Coder will accurately code and abstract diagnoses and procedures from medical records for outpatient services, ensuring compliance with regulatory guidelines while working remotely from Northern California.
Key responsibilities
- Review medical records to identify and code diagnoses and procedures using ICD-CM, CPT, and HCPCS systems
- Organize and prioritize work assignments to ensure timely and compliant coding in accordance with regulatory requirements
- Interact with physicians to clarify patient diagnostic and procedural information as needed
Required qualifications
- Two years of continuous hospital coding/abstracting experience within the last five years
- High School Diploma or GED with completion of relevant medical coding classes from an accredited program
- Certification as a Registered Health Information Technician, Certified Professional Coder, or equivalent
- Basic knowledge of anatomy, physiology, and medical terminology related to coding
- Ability to meet established productivity and quality standards for coding and abstracting
